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1091 20796311676 36703
5557 41668149 473177
5557 41668149 473177
802112 194 89926490 24
All about undefined
Interested in learning more?
5557 41668149 473177
802112 194 89926490 24
See more
8484396812 91380903
53682160518 0869331 52074660336
See more
61 03241247683 32319423
9093 353096122 43 124650653
See more